 | ANTIQUARIAN HOROLOGICAL SOCIETY : TIME AND PLACE - ENGLISH COUNTRY CLOCKS 1600-1840 Ref: 3498 £30.00 | |
| 270pp Illus SC 2006 A welcome addition and high quality publication which is much more than just a catalogue of the exhibition of the same name held from Nov 2006 to April 2007 at Oxford. The illustrations accompanying each of the knowledgable and full descriptions of 68 exhibits are of a very high quality, revealing the finer detail of movements and case design. Also includes a good bibliography of regional makers and list of UK museums with horological exhibits. |

 | BAKER GL, BLACKBURN JA : THE PENDULUM: A CASE STUDY IN PHYSICS Ref: 2904 £49.00 | |
| 300pp 2005 Illus, halftones. Provides fascinating information about the history of the pendulum and what scientists thought it did, the revolution wrought by Foucault, the special cases of the torsion pendulum, the chaotic pendulum, the quantum pendulum, and coupled pendulums, the effects of superconductivity, and the most familiar to most of us, the pendulum clock. Includes information on special interests in the appendices, such as the inverted pendulum and the longnow clock. |

 | BETTS J : TIME RESTORED: THE HARRISON TIMEKEEPERS AND R T GOULD THE MAN WHO KNEW (ALMOST) EVERYTHING Ref: 2082 £40.00 | |
| 480pp Illus 2006. The first and long awaited biography of polymath Rupert Gould, who in the 1920's restored the great 18th century maritime timekeepers by John Harrison. The book represents a significant and unique contribution to the History of Technology as well as to horology. Extensively and extremely well illustrated it will be suitable for historians of science and a wide general readership with Jonathan Betts' knowledge from his position at the Royal Observatory, National Maritime Museum, Greenwich ensuring an authoritative record.  | SMITH B : SMITHS DOMESTIC CLOCKS: 2008 EDITION Ref: 3377 £20.00 | |
| 290pp Illus SC 2008 already into a second much expanded edition, this is the main reference source on Smiths clocks. After many years research Barrie Smith has assembled all available information on the history of the company,factory photographs and an indexed picture gallery that will allow collectors and owners of Smiths clocks to date and name individual models. The new edition contains an additional 100 pages and includes details of 2150 clocks and timers ( synchronous, sectric, manual etc ) as well as appendices listing the varaitions by model and years of manufacture. |

 | ZANTKE H : LOUIS-BENJAMIN AUDEMARS: HIS LIFE AND WORK Ref: 3351 £85.00 | |
| 512 pp 434 col. & 169 b/w illustrations, slipcase. This book tells the life story of Louis-Benjamin Audemars and his sons, the most important Swiss watchmakers of the 19th century. The amazing works of this watchmaking dynasty are illustrated by more than 600 illustrations, some larger than life size, of more than 160 watches made by the Louis Audemars factory and its successors. Author is a specialist in the history of the Louis-Benjamin Audemars dynasty. |
